What exactly is ‚green dating‘?

Green relationship, for anyone not really acquainted with the new title, is simply the close seek out an eco-mindful individual that offers its thinking and their interest in action on weather change.
As with many relationship trends, green dating was born from a necessity for singles to make sure their values are aligned with the person they’re dating. With 75 percent of British adults admitting to being concerned about our climate future, per an ONS survey, it’s not surprising that climate change is influencing the way people want to date.
Dating apps like Bumble and Elite Singles have been quick to cater to the upsurge in eco-minded daters offering badges‘ that indicate interest, while other smaller apps, such as Environmentally friendly Men and women and Grazer are popping up to allow flirty conversations within the niche.
